The Effect of a Clean Workplace on Productivity

The phrase ‘tidy desk, tidy mind’ exists for a reason. 

Our brains act as reflections of the work around us, so when our environment is chaotic, our brains can become equally so. 

Having an organized, clean desk makes resources and documents easier to access, saving you hours wasted rifling through piles to find what you’re looking for. 

Clean workplaces offer fewer distractions, too. 

If you’re focusing on the thick layer of dust you can see on your desk or the unpleasant smell coming from the kitchen, you’re less likely to be able to concentrate on your work. A clean workplace, on the other hand, equals a distraction-free workplace. 

The Negative Effects of a Dirty Workplace on Productivity

Dirty, messy workplaces make it harder for employees to concentrate, which massively impacts productivity. 

Consider, for example, that the average person wastes up to 4 hours per week searching for paper. If your desk is untidy and resources aren’t easily accessible, you’ll waste time that could be spent on income-generating activities.

The Impact of Cleanliness on Employee Health

For your employees to be productive, they have to actually be working. One of the benefits of a clean office is reduced absenteeism, thanks to a reduction in the harmful germs that cause viruses. 

The area on your desk when your hands rest harbors 10,000 bacteria alone. Regular surface wiping and sanitizing will reduce the likelihood of catching and spreading illnesses. 

And it’s not just physical health that’s affected.

Employees see a marked improvement in mental health when their working space is cleaner and tidier, along with a better ability to concentrate. 

Addressing well-being at work improves productivity by an impressive 12%, so not only will your employee’s health benefit, but your bottom line will, too. 

How Office Design Affects Cleanliness

There are actually ways of designing your workplace to make it more hygienic. To avoid spreading disease, keep desks at a suitable distance from one another and use proper filters in your air conditioning unit to improve air quality. 

An easy way of arranging desks that prioritizes personal space and hygiene is the ‘top and tail’ layout. Arrange your seating so employees don’t sit directly facing each other but still have a line of sight. 

Hand sanitizing stations should be easily accessible around the workplace to stop the spread of germs. Placing plants and shrubbery around the room also helps air quality by increasing oxygen levels. 

To encourage staff members to keep their workspaces clean, provide every workstation with access to surface cleaning equipment and anti-bacterial spray. 

Tips for Keeping a Clean Workplace

If you’re passionate about keeping your workforce happy and healthy, implement the following tips for a cleaner workplace. 

Clean little and often

Prevention is better than cure, as they say, and that’s never truer than when it comes to office and workplace cleaning. 

You can avoid a build-up of dust, dirt, and clutter by keeping on top of your workplace’s appearance with a daily wipe of surfaces. 

Empty the trash as soon as it’s full, and refill items such as soap and consumables regularly.

Create a Filing System

Clutter isn’t just unsightly; it can lead to a build-up of dirt since the space underneath the chaos is rarely cleaned. 

To improve your company’s organization and reduce the amount of loose paperwork, create a filing system that employees can follow to keep their desks free from stray documents.
